title = "AdJustMoment: Customize Your Ad Watching Experience",
abstract = "Ads are ubiquitous on online video platforms, providing significant commercial value but also often interrupting viewers at inopportune moments. This can be particularly disruptive for mobile users, whose diverse contexts of use can mean time for video watching is limited. Prior research indicates that allowing users to negotiate or defer interruptions can reduce disruption. Inspired by this, we developed AdJustMoment, a mobile video player application that imports content from online platforms and offers users the option to defer ads through {"}Snooze{"}or {"}Ads-debt{"}- user-determined ads-viewing times. Our preliminary qualitative feedback indicates a preference for {"}Ads-debt{"}, as users felt it provided greater control over when ads appear. Additionally, users also desire to receive positive feedback upon completing an ad, as it serves as a motivational factor.",
